Stuffed Sumatran tigers, ivory and other confiscated items made from endangered animals being destroyed at the Aceh Forestry Ministry Office in Banda Aceh, Indonesia, yesterday. The items were seized from poachers and illegal traders of wild animals in Aceh province as the country's authorities continue their fight against the illegal trade in wild animals and the products made from them.
